noun 
  1. (uncountable) power, Power, strength, force or influence held by a person or group.
  2. (uncountable) physical, Physical strength.
He pushed with all his , but still it would not move.
  1. (uncountable) The ability to do something.

verb 
  1. (auxiliary) (simple past of, may)
  2. (auxiliary) Used to indicate conditional or possible actions.
